Understanding the Core of Clinical Coding
Clinical coding is the process of converting patient diagnosis and treatment information into universally recognized codes for billing and insurance purposes. The Advanced Certificate in Accurate Clinical Coding Techniques is designed to equip professionals with the skills needed to navigate this complex terrain. This certificate covers a wide range of topics, including the latest coding standards, ICD-10-CM and CPT updates, and the nuances of documentation that ensure accurate coding.
# Practical Application: Coding Complex Diagnoses
One of the most challenging aspects of clinical coding is dealing with complex diagnoses. For instance, a patient presenting with symptoms of fatigue, weight loss, and frequent urination might have diabetes. Accurate coding requires understanding the patient’s full clinical picture and selecting the most appropriate codes. In the Advanced Certificate program, you learn to use the ICD-10-CM code set to capture the primary and secondary diagnoses accurately. This not only improves reimbursement but also ensures that the patient’s medical record reflects the full scope of their health issues.
